    A Bootstrap Look At Yahoo! Pure CSS Framework

    Yahoo! Pure CSS framework is a minimalistic grid and style system for your apps. It only contains one "component", and is focused on being extensible rather than comprehensive. But how does it stack up against Twitter Bootstrap? In this apples to oranges comparison, we take a Bootstrap look at Yahoo! Pure CSS.
